I want a sweet cocktail with whisky.

cocktail colin avatar

Cocktail Colin says:

quote start

If you're looking for a sweet cocktail that prominently features whisky, there are a few excellent options to consider, each with its unique flair and taste profile.

One top recommendation would be the Manhattan Sweet. With a nearly perfect rating of 4.9/5, this classic cocktail has stood the test of time since its inception in late 1800s New York City. It features a harmonious blend of red vermouth, angostura bitters, and bourbon. The red vermouth provides a rich, velvety sweetness, balanced by the bitter undertone of Angostura bitters and the robust, smoky flavor of bourbon. It’s a perfect choice if you want an elegant and sophisticated sweet whisky cocktail.

Another delightful option is the Winter Whisky Sour, which offers a seasonal twist on the classic Whisky Sour. With a rating of 4.8/5, this cocktail incorporates orange and lemon juice, balanced with sugar syrup to provide a sweet and tangy experience that highlights the warming notes of bourbon. This cocktail is especially fitting for the colder months or festive occasions, providing a refreshing yet cozy beverage.

Lastly, consider trying the Sugar Daddy. This cocktail has a rating of 4.7/5 and is an inventive take on the classic Godfather. It substitutes root beer schnapps for amaretto, resulting in a smooth and complex drink that retains the familiar root beer flavor while softening the kick of the whiskey. It's creamy, oddly complex, and surprisingly drinkable, a great match if you prefer something a bit different yet still sweet.

All these cocktails are excellent choices that balance the sweetness with the robust character of whisky, ensuring a delightful and satisfying drinking experience!

What makes a cocktail sweet?

A cocktail is made sweet by the presence of sugar or sweet ingredients like syrups, liqueurs, or fruit juices. These components help balance the strong or bitter flavors of spirits, making the cocktail more palatable.

question icon image

How does whisky work in sweet cocktails?

Whisky adds a rich, deep flavor to cocktails, which can be complemented by sweet ingredients. The caramel and vanilla notes in whisky often pair well with sweeteners, creating balanced drinks that highlight the whisky's character.

question icon image

Why is bourbon often used in sweet cocktails?

Bourbon has natural caramel and vanilla flavors due to the aging process in charred oak barrels. These sweet notes make it an ideal spirit for sweet cocktails, allowing it to blend well with other sugary components.

question icon image

What are Angostura bitters used for in cocktails?

Angostura bitters are used to add depth, complexity, and aromatic notes to cocktails. They're typically used in small amounts to balance sweet and sour flavors, enhancing the overall taste profile of the drink.

question icon image

Is there a difference between whisky and whiskey in cocktails?

The difference between whisky and whiskey often refers to regional spelling variations. Whisky is typically from Scotland, Canada, or Japan, while whiskey comes from Ireland or the U.S. Each has unique flavor profiles, affecting the cocktails in which they're used.
